Selecting the right flipbelt bottle size requires balancing your anticipated run duration with the physical weight you are comfortable carrying around your waist. While a running belt is designed to hold items snugly against your body, carrying water introduces dynamic weight that shifts with every stride. Choosing a capacity that is too small can leave you dehydrated, while selecting a bottle that is too large can cause unnecessary bouncing and discomfort.
To make the right choice, you must look beyond the distance on your training plan. Your individual pace, local environmental conditions, and personal sweat rate all dictate how much fluid you actually need to carry. By evaluating these factors systematically, you can select a bottle setup that keeps you hydrated without compromising your running form.
Estimating Hydration Needs Based on Run Distance and Duration
Distance is a convenient metric for planning runs, but it is actually a proxy for time on feet. A ten-kilometer run might take an experienced athlete forty minutes, whereas a beginner or trail runner might require over eighty minutes to cover the same distance. Because your body loses fluids continuously through sweat and respiration, your hydration strategy must be calculated based on duration rather than kilometers alone.

For shorter efforts lasting under forty-five minutes, your body typically relies on pre-run hydration. During these brief sessions, the physiological demand for immediate fluid replacement is relatively low, meaning you can often run comfortably without carrying water. However, once your time on feet exceeds one hour, baseline fluid loss accelerates, making consistent hydration essential to maintain performance and prevent cardiovascular strain.

Your running pace also directly influences your thermal load and sweat rate. Running at a higher intensity increases your core body temperature, which triggers more profuse sweating to facilitate cooling. Consequently, a fast-paced five-kilometer tempo run in warm weather might demand more immediate post-run hydration than a slow, easy eight-kilometer recovery run in cooler conditions.
Matching FlipBelt Bottle Capacities to Your Typical Runs
FlipBelt bottles are specifically designed with a curved profile to contour to your waist, minimizing movement when tucked into the belt’s pockets. These bottles are typically available in several sizes, most commonly around 170ml (6oz) and 250ml (8.5oz). Matching these capacities to your typical training distances is the first step in building an ergonomic hydration system.

Smaller capacity bottles, such as the 170ml option, are highly streamlined and lightweight. When filled, a 170ml bottle adds minimal bulk, making it virtually unnoticeable against your lower back or hip. This size is ideal for short-to-medium distances, such as five-kilometer to ten-kilometer runs, or any session lasting under an hour where you simply need a few sips of water or a diluted energy gel solution to keep your mouth moist.
Larger capacity bottles, such as the 250ml option, are better suited for longer training runs, half-marathon preparation, or extended trail sessions. The extra volume provides a more substantial safety net when you are far from water fountains or running for ninety minutes or more. However, because water weighs approximately one gram per milliliter, a fully loaded 250ml bottle adds significant weight to your waist, requiring a secure belt fit to prevent movement.

Adjusting for Singapore's Climate and Personal Sweat Rate
Running in Singapore’s consistently hot and humid tropical climate drastically alters your hydration requirements. High relative humidity levels prevent sweat from evaporating efficiently off your skin, which is the body’s primary method of cooling itself. Because evaporation is hindered, your body continues to produce sweat in an attempt to cool down, leading to exceptionally high fluid and electrolyte loss even during moderate runs.
To adapt your bottle choice to this environment, you should observe and calculate your personal sweat rate. You can perform a simple sweat test by weighing yourself on a digital scale immediately before and after a sixty-minute run, ensuring you dry off any excess sweat before the post-run measurement. Subtracting your post-run weight from your pre-run weight (and accounting for any water consumed during the run) provides a clear picture of your hourly fluid loss.
If your sweat test reveals that you are a heavy sweater, or if you plan to run during peak heat hours in Singapore, you will need to adjust your carrying capacity upward. This might mean opting for the larger 250ml bottle for runs where a cooler climate would only require 170ml. Alternatively, you can plan your running routes along paths with public water coolers, such as coastal park connectors, using your bottle as a portable reservoir that you refill at regular intervals.
While carrying extra fluid is vital for safety in hot climates, you must balance this need with physical comfort. Carrying too much water adds dead weight that can fatigue your core and lower back muscles over long distances. Experiment with different fluid volumes during your training to find the sweet spot where you remain adequately hydrated without feeling weighed down.
Balancing Weight, Bulk, and Belt Fit
Carrying water on your waist introduces physical forces that can disrupt your running stride if your gear is not optimized. A larger, heavier bottle places more demand on the elasticity of your running belt. If the belt is too loose or the bottle is poorly positioned, the weight will cause the belt to bounce, sag, or ride up toward your stomach, which can lead to painful chafing and distraction.
To minimize bounce, pay close attention to how you distribute weight within your belt. The most stable position for a curved bottle is typically at the small of your back, resting directly over your sacrum where pelvic movement is minimal. If you are carrying other heavy items, such as a large smartphone, keys, or energy gels, place them on the opposite side of the belt to create a balanced counterweight.
Checking the manufacturer’s sizing chart is essential before selecting both your belt and your bottle. A belt that fits perfectly when empty may feel overly tight or constricting once you slide a filled 250ml bottle into the pocket. Conversely, if you choose a belt size that is too large, it will lack the tension required to hold a heavy bottle snugly against your hips.
Before committing to your hydration setup for a major race or a challenging long run, perform a short shakeout run with a fully loaded belt. Use this brief session to check for any signs of friction, bouncing, or shifting. If you experience discomfort, try adjusting the vertical position of the belt on your hips or shifting the bottle slightly to the left or right until it feels secure.
Common Sizing Mistakes to Avoid
One of the most frequent errors runners make is overestimating their fluid needs for short, easy recovery runs. Carrying a heavy, fully filled bottle on a thirty-minute run adds unnecessary weight and increases the risk of chafing, when a simple pre-run glass of water would have sufficed. Keep your short runs light and streamlined to focus on recovery and form.
Conversely, underestimating fluid loss during long runs in high humidity can lead to early fatigue, muscle cramps, or heat exhaustion. Assuming you can run fifteen kilometers in tropical heat with only a tiny bottle of water is a safety risk. If you prefer not to carry a larger bottle, you must actively plan a route that features reliable public water sources for refills.
Another common mistake is ignoring how weight distribution affects the fit of the belt. Placing a heavy bottle directly over your hip bone can cause the hard plastic to rub against your skin, leading to bruising or raw spots. Always utilize the rear pocket for larger bottles, and ensure the curved side of the bottle matches the natural curve of your lower back.
Finally, do not rely solely on distance markers to dictate your hydration schedule. A trail run of ten kilometers over technical, muddy terrain will take significantly longer than ten kilometers on a flat, paved track. Always calculate your hydration capacity based on the estimated time you will spend exposed to the elements rather than the physical distance of the route.

Can I carry two smaller FlipBelt bottles instead of one large one?
Yes, carrying two smaller 170ml bottles is an excellent strategy for distributing weight more evenly around your waist. By placing one bottle at the front and one at the back, you balance the load and reduce the localized pressure that a single, larger 250ml bottle might create. This dual-bottle setup also allows you to carry water in one bottle and an electrolyte or carbohydrate mix in the other, giving you more flexibility during long-distance training runs.
Do I need to carry a FlipBelt bottle for runs under 5K?
For most runners, carrying a bottle for distances under five kilometers is unnecessary, provided you have hydrated adequately before stepping out the door. However, if you are running in extreme heat, recovering from illness, or have a medical condition that requires frequent sips of water, carrying a small 170ml bottle can provide peace of mind. If you choose to run without water, ensure you have access to fluids immediately upon completing your run.
